相关文章
使用Python开发PDF文本提取工具
在日常工作中,我们经常需要从PDF文档中提取文本内容。虽然市面上有不少相关工具,但它们要么功能过于复杂,要么使用不够方便。本文将介绍如何使用Python开发一个简单实用的PDF文本提取工具,该工具具有图形界面,操作简单…
建站知识
2025/4/22 4:00:55
go flag参数 类似Java main 的args
两部分内容
go run test1.go aa -name 123
1. 解析:aa -name 123
2. 解析:name 123
代码
package mainimport ("log""os"
)func main() {log.Println("main ...")if len(os.Args) > 0 {for index, arg : ra…
建站知识
2025/4/22 10:10:33
23种设计模式之《外观模式(Facade)》在c#中的应用及理解
程序设计中的主要设计模式通常分为三大类,共23种:
1. 创建型模式(Creational Patterns) 单例模式(Singleton):确保一个类只有一个实例,并提供全局访问点。 工厂方法模式࿰…
建站知识
2025/4/22 3:05:58
基于Spring Boot的农事管理系统设计与实现(LW+源码+讲解)
专注于大学生项目实战开发,讲解,毕业答疑辅导,欢迎高校老师/同行前辈交流合作✌。 技术范围:SpringBoot、Vue、SSM、HLMT、小程序、Jsp、PHP、Nodejs、Python、爬虫、数据可视化、安卓app、大数据、物联网、机器学习等设计与开发。 主要内容:…
建站知识
2025/4/22 1:40:02
FFmpeg 是什么?为什么?怎么用?
摘要:本文介绍了 FFmpeg,一个功能强大的开源多媒体处理工具,广泛应用于视频和音频文件的处理。FFmpeg 支持多种多媒体格式,能够实现视频编码/解码、格式转换、裁剪、合并、音频提取、流媒体处理等功能。本文详细阐述了 FFmpeg 的主…
建站知识
2025/4/22 4:01:29
常用加解密原理及实际使用
AES加解密
在Java中,可以使用javax.crypto包来实现AES-256加密和解密,使用java.security包来实现RSA-2048加密和解密。以下是一个简单的示例,展示了如何使用AES-256和RSA-2048进行加密和解密。
样例
import javax.crypto.Cipher;
import j…
建站知识
2025/4/22 4:18:58
如何制作安装包打包软件
实现原理
本质就是将exe所需的所有资源制作为一个自解压文件(SFX)。
打包软件
本体
taurirust做配置界面
打包文件夹界面方式(本地文件-单页面应用/网址)起始界面(资源路径)pip(可新增)install(进度回调)complete(选项设置-快捷方式)
打包自解压
使用rust打包
[
depend…
建站知识
2025/4/18 8:06:10
25工程管理研究生复试面试问题汇总 工程管理专业知识问题很全! 工程管理复试全流程攻略 工程管理考研复试真题汇总
工程管理复试面试心里没底?别慌!学姐手把手教你怎么应对复试!
很多同学面对复试总担心踩坑,其实只要避开雷区掌握核心技巧,逆袭上岸完全有可能!这份保姆级指南帮你快速锁定重点,时间紧迫优先背…
建站知识
2025/4/12 2:40:16